摘要
以甲基丙烯酸十二氟庚酯、丙烯酸乙酯、甲基丙烯酸甲酯以及丙烯酸为主要原料,采用半连续乳液聚合方法制备具有核壳结构的氟化聚丙烯酸酯乳液,并将其用于皮革涂饰。采用傅里叶红外光谱、光电子能谱、投射电子显微镜、热重法等,研究了制备产物的结构及性能。结果表明:此法可制备出泛蓝光的氟化聚丙烯酸酯乳液,该乳液具有良好的稳定性且粒子的核壳结构明显,胶膜具有较高的耐热稳定性。用其涂饰的皮革的防水性能明显提高。
The fluorinated acrylate emulsion with core-shell structure was prepared with dodecafluoroheptyl meth- acrylate, ethyl acrylate, methyl methacrylate and acrylic acid used as main raw materials through semi-continuous e- mulsion polymerization method, and it was applied to leather finishing. Structures and properties of the prepared prod- uct were studied by FT-IR, XPS, TEM and TG and so on. Results indicate that this method can be used to prepare bluish fluorinated polyacrylate emulsion. The emulsion has has relatively high thermal stability.
